The idea of resurrecting extinct animals, once confined to the realm of science fiction, is rapidly becoming a reality. Colossal Biosciences, a company founded by serial entrepreneur Ben Lamm, is at the forefront of this movement, aiming to bring back iconic creatures like the woolly mammoth and the dodo. While Lamm acknowledges the parallels between his work and the fictionalized de-extinction depicted in Steven Spielberg’s Jurassic Park,he emphasizes the crucial differences in approach and ethical considerations.
“People have to remember that that was a movie, right?” Lamm says, referring to the blockbuster film. “We’re not filling in gaps with frog DNA.”
Instead, Colossal Biosciences utilizes a more sophisticated and ethical approach. Their process begins with obtaining ancient DNA samples from ancient specimens, often housed in museums or discovered in the field.these samples are then compared to the genomes of the closest living relatives, such as the Asian elephant for the woolly mammoth.
“First you have to get ancient DNA, right, and that exists sometimes in museums, sometimes in the field. A lot of researchers have actually already done the work,” lamm explains. “So we work with the top ancient DNA researchers in the world.”
Using advanced AI-powered comparative genomics, scientists identify the specific genes responsible for the unique characteristics of the extinct species. These genes are then ”engineered in” to the cells of a closely related living species, such as an elephant, through a process called somatic cell nuclear transfer. This technique, pioneered in Edinburgh, involves transferring the nucleus of a cell containing the modified genetic material into an egg cell that has had its own nucleus removed. The resulting embryo is then implanted into a surrogate mother.
“We’re in the editing phase on cells on both the mammoth and the thylacine, which is awesome,” Lamm states, highlighting the company’s progress.
Colossal Biosciences aims to bring the first woolly mammoth calf into the world by late 2028, born to a surrogate elephant mother. This ambitious goal is driven by the belief that de-extinction can play a vital role in conservation efforts.
Beyond reviving iconic species, Lamm envisions a future where de-extinction technology can be used to protect endangered animals from extinction.”It is this latter process that Lamm hopes could be used to protect existing animal species,such as the vanishingly rare northern white rhino,from dying out,” the article states.The company is also exploring the progress of artificial wombs, which could possibly be used to gestate and birth animals without the need for surrogate mothers. Lamm believes this technology could revolutionize conservation efforts by providing a safe and controlled habitat for endangered species to reproduce.
“We may achieve that with a small mammal, perhaps a mouse, within two years,” Lamm says, referring to the artificial womb technology.

Bringing Back the Dodo: Can Technology Rewrite Extinction?
The idea of resurrecting extinct animals,once confined to the realm of science fiction,is rapidly becoming a reality. Ben Lamm, co-founder of Colossal Biosciences, a company dedicated to de-extinction, believes that we are on the cusp of a new era in conservation.
“like the sheep: only now we use robotics and lasers. Back then they were using, like, this,” he says, picking up a table knife and gesturing. “The fact that Dolly worked was a miracle!” Lamm is referring to Dolly the sheep, the first mammal cloned from an adult cell, a landmark achievement in 1996.
While Dolly’s cloning was a monumental leap, the technology has advanced significantly since then. Colossal Biosciences is leveraging cutting-edge gene editing tools like CRISPR-Cas9 and advanced robotics to bring back species like the woolly mammoth and the thylacine (Tasmanian tiger).
“We’re in the editing phase on cells on both the mammoth and the thylacine, which is awesome. We’re not quiet there on the dodo yet. We’re still doing the computational biology work,” Lamm explains, suggesting a potential announcement of progress on the dodo front within the next six months.
The company’s ambitious goal is to create herds or flocks of these resurrected species, allowing them to roam free in their natural habitats. Lamm envisions mammoths grazing across the frozen plains of the Arctic tundra and dodos once again inhabiting the forests of Madagascar.
“What everyone generally agrees is that a more biodiverse ecosystem is a healthier one: so one with predators, one with large megafauna, one with large herbivores,” Lamm argues, pointing to research suggesting that restoring “keystone herbivores” like mammoths could actually benefit the environment.
He emphasizes the importance of collaboration, stating, “With all the species that we’re working on, we were working with indigenous people, groups, private landowners and governments to put them back in the wild in their natural habitats.”
Lamm’s journey into de-extinction is a testament to his entrepreneurial spirit and passion for science. He has already co-founded and sold five successful technology companies, including Conversable, a precursor to large language models, and Chaotic Moon Studios, a creative software company acquired by Accenture in 2015.
His foray into de-extinction was sparked by a meeting with George Church, a renowned Harvard professor and pioneer in synthetic biology. Church, who envisioned bringing back the mammoth, saw in Lamm a kindred spirit and a partner to make his dream a reality.
“I was like: let’s do that!” Lamm recalls,highlighting the shared enthusiasm that fueled the creation of Colossal Biosciences.
While the company’s primary mission is conservation, Lamm acknowledges the potential for commercial applications. Colossal Biosciences has already spun out two businesses and plans to create more, leveraging the technologies developed for de-extinction to address other challenges.
“My background is building technology companies,” Lamm explains.”And then I met a guy named George Church. George is, like, the father of synthetic biology. He’s the guy, and this was his idea.”

The Ethical and Practical Challenges of De-Extinction
while the prospect of bringing back extinct species is undeniably exciting,it also raises significant ethical and practical concerns.
Ecological Impact: Reintroducing extinct species into ecosystems could have unforeseen consequences. For example, the return of mammoths to the Arctic tundra could disrupt existing food chains and alter the landscape.
Animal Welfare: Resurrected animals may face challenges adapting to their new environments and could suffer from genetic defects or health problems.
Resource Allocation: De-extinction is a costly and resource-intensive endeavor. Critics argue that these resources could be better spent on protecting existing endangered species.
Playing God: Some people believe that de-extinction is morally wrong, as it involves interfering with the natural order of life and death.
